Back in October, the Timberwolves had high hopes for their 2012-13 NBA season. Even though Ricky Rubio was still recovering from a torn ACL, they thought they had a legitimate chance to make the 2013 NBA Playoffs. So much for that.

For the second time this season, the T'Wolves—who are currently in last place in the Western Conference's Northwest Division—will be without superstar Kevin Love for an extended period of time. He just broke his right handfor the second time and, this time, his injury required surgery. So, he'll be out for at least eight weeks and reportedly won't rush back from his injury like he did the first time. And, as a result, the T'Wolves' playoff hopes have all but disappeared.
